之前在一个springboot项目中开启了access.log日志(参见spring boot打开tomcat的access日志),现在可以很方便的根据access日志统计时延。先看日志文件: 再看access.log里的8个字段: %h %l %u %t"%r"%s %b %D 这几个字段都是啥意思? %h = 发起请求的客户端 IP 地址 %l = 客户机的 RFC 1413 标识 ( 参考 ...
Spring Boot(3.1.10) 默认使用了内置的 Tomcat(10.1.19) application.yml配置 server:port:8080tomcat:accesslog:enabled:truepattern:"%{yyyy-MM-dd HH:mm:ss}t [%I]%{X-Forwarded-For}i %a %r %q %s (%{ms}T ms)"directory:./prefix:access_logsuffix:.logbasedir:/logsremoteip:remote-ip-header:...
二、Tomcat通过%D或%T统计请求响应时间 server.xml使用配置方式 <Valve className="org.apache.catalina.valves.AccessLogValve" directory="logs" prefix="localhost_access_log." suffix=".txt" pattern="%h %l %u [%{yyyy-MM-dd HH:mm:ss}t] %{X-Real_IP}i "%r" %s %b %D %F" /> 1. 2. 3....
localhost.{yyyy-MM-dd}.log 主要是应用初始化(listener, filter, servlet)未处理的异常最后被 Tomcat 捕获而输出的日志,它也是包含 Tomcat 的启动和暂停时的运行日志,但它没有 catalina.YYYY-MM-DD.log 日志全。 localhost_access_log.YYYY-MM-DD.txt# Tomcat 的请求访问日志,请求的时间,请求的类型,请求的资...
在Tomcat中,localhost_access_log是用于记录访问日志的文件,它提供了关于客户端请求和服务器响应的详细信息。以下是Tomcat的localhost_access_log日志中的标准属性、它们的含义、配置方法、访问方式以及处理和分析这些日志的建议工具或方法。 1. 标准属性及含义 date: 请求到达服务器的日期和时间。 time-taken: 服务器处...
springboot 1.x 内置tomcat服务器,其中的access log日志可以记录每次请求、响应的一些关键信息,这为我们排查分析系统性能有很大的帮助。 但springboot默认是不开启access log的,下面介绍下access log的开启方式和一些日志格式配置。 二、环境 jdk 8 srpingboot 1.56 ...
二、Tomcat通过%D或%T统计请求响应时间 server.xml使用配置方式 <Valve className="org.apache.catalina.valves.AccessLogValve" directory="logs" prefix="localhost_access_log." suffix=".txt" pattern="%h %l %u [%{yyyy-MM-dd HH:mm:ss}t] %{X-Real_IP}i "%r" %s %b%D%F" /> ...
通过Nginx,Tomcat访问⽇志(accesslog)记录请求耗时⼀、Nginx通过$upstream_response_time $request_time统计请求和后台服务响应时间 nginx.conf使⽤配置⽅式:log_format main '$remote_addr - $remote_user [$time_local] "$request" ''$status $body_bytes_sent "$http_referer" ''"$http_user_agent...
首先是配置tomcat访问日志数据,配置的方式如下Valve参数说明: 打开${catalina}/conf/server.xml文件 注:${catalina}是tomcat的安装目录 <Valve className="org.apache.catalina.valves.AccessLogValve" directory="logs"prefix="localhost_access_log" suffix=".txt"pattern="%h %l %u %t "%r" %s %b" /> ...
TOMCAT 开启访问日志功能(ACCESS LOG)修改位置如下图 具体的解释如下 Access Log Valve用来创建日志文件,格式与标准的web server日志文件相同。可以使用用日志分析工具对日志进行分析,跟踪页面点击次数、用户会话的活动等。Access Log Valve 的很多配置和行为特性与File Logger相同,包括每晚午夜自动切换日志文件。Access ...